Episode 1: Volleyball Alumna CC McGraw Launches on National Girls & Women in Sports Day 

MINNEAPOLIS – The University of Minnesota Athletics, in its continued commitment to spotlight the next generation of female leaders, launches its newest original content series entitled “Athletes in Leadership” on National Girls & Women in Sports Day.

This marks the third video series done in conjunction with Gopher sponsors Unilever and Cub and alongside the university’s athletics multimedia rightsholder, LEARFIELD’s Gopher Sports Properties. Additionally, LEARFIELD Studios served as the Gophers’ creative development and production partner as it did with the aforementioned “Women in Leadership” and “Girls in Leadership” series.

Episode 1: “Athletes in Leadership” features volleyball graduate student CC McGraw. It is now live on the series’ dedicated page within GopherSports.com. Fans can watch the debut episode highlighting McGraw, who boasted a stellar five-year career for the Gophers while representing her home state. She talks openly about social media detox and the importance of setting boundaries around the frequency and use of engaging on social platforms.

Episodes 2-4 also will spotlight U of M female student-athletes addressing other key topics that include body positivity, self-esteem and sustainability. They candidly share their perspectives with fans and discuss how they choose to live out their daily lives on campus as they intently focus on achieving their academic and athletic endeavors.

The subsequent release schedule is as follows:

Episode 2 – Mya Hooten, Minnesota Gymnastics (Feb. 8)

Episode 3 – Taylor Landfair, Minnesota Volleyball (Feb. 15)

Episode 4 – Taylor Heise, Minnesota Hockey (Feb. 22)

For Unilever and Cub, the “Athletes in Leadership” series presents a unique opportunity to leverage their respective brands with student-athlete name, image and likeness (NIL). As longtime Gopher corporate partners with use of university IP, Gopher Sports Properties ensured the new NIL component was incorporated into their current sponsorships. LEARFIELD, which does not represent student-athletes, helps its school and brand partners navigate the permissible ins and outs of NIL and brand engagement.
